Just because a person is injured on a business's property does not mean the business is automatically liable.
Each person has a duty to protect oneself. That is, did you watch where you were going?
A business must have notice of the danger. That is, was the food on the floor long enough that the business had an opportunity to notice the fallen food to clean it up?
Many businesses have insurance that will provide some medical expense coverage to injured customers regardless of fault. You can check if the business has such insurance.
